Transaction

68708f67d1af4f419f2fa5e9f4ec044dbec2be78ff9b3f13e052f1de1390f441
347,654 confirmations
Timestamp
1567521499
Block593,075
Fee163,779 sats
Fee rate29.7 sats/vB
view on mempool.space

Inputs & Outputs

Inputs